Output d70a12bc4d911351c176afcb0d7ffe2338338906c8cc34af4dc05a90e32febe0:1

value
22434569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e4fe97eebc9581181ef7cf01143a1da556fa48f OP_EQUAL
address
MAfSEaHPwZsk5weR6aUhDDhWjtKqMmbrwe
transaction
d70a12bc4d911351c176afcb0d7ffe2338338906c8cc34af4dc05a90e32febe0
spent
true